  • Community Media Hub - Media is fourth pillar of democracy. Voices of marginalized are very weak in media. Due to lack of representation in the mainstream media, the voices of those belonging to marginalized communities often go unheard by much of Indian society. The media also is a part of the same society which has same discriminatory hierarchical power structures based on gender, caste, class, religion. Additionally, members of marginalized communities lack the resources and platform to raise the issues of their communities on a wider scale. There is a big question what to do to correct this in the society and also media? We need to talk about it, talk loud, talk to the whole world. To correct these imbalances, Parivartan Kendra aims to develop a community media hub in the Vaishali district of Bihar. It will in future aim at getting the representation of the marginalized Dalit and Muslim communities in Media which will strengthen democracy in itself, also contribute to the movement/s against human rights violations, give visual effect of consolidation of thousand of voices and also support and empower the victims of Human rights violation. In April 2013, Parivartan Kendra conducted an introductory training workshop in Mahua block of Vaishali district of Bihar on the production and use of video to tell stories.
